An unknown sample has a volume of 3.61 cm3 and a mass of 9.93 g. What is the density (g/cm3) of the unknown?

Answer:

2.75 g/cm³

Explanation:

given,

Volume of unknown sample, V = 3.61 cm³

mass of the sample, m = 9.93 g

density = ?

We know,

[tex]density = \dfrac{mass}{volume}[/tex]

[tex]\rho= \dfrac{9.93}{3.61}[/tex]

[tex]\rho = 2.75\ g/cm^3[/tex]

Hence, density of the unknown sample is equal to 2.75 g/cm³
